Overview

The MAX5841MEUB is a 10-bit digital-to-analog converter (DAC) manufactured by Maxim Integrated. It is designed for applications requiring high precision and low power consumption, such as audio equipment, instrumentation, and industrial control systems. The device features a serial interface, which simplifies integration with microcontrollers and other digital systems. The MAX5841MEUB is known for its excellent linearity and low glitch energy, ensuring accurate and stable analog output. Its compact form factor and robust performance make it a popular choice among engineers and designers in both industrial and consumer electronics sectors.

Structure and Working Principle

The MAX5841MEUB operates by converting digital input signals into corresponding analog voltages. It utilizes a resistor ladder network to achieve its 10-bit resolution, providing 1024 possible output levels. The device includes an internal reference voltage, which can be bypassed if an external reference is preferred. The serial interface allows for easy communication with microcontrollers or digital signal processors. The DAC outputs a voltage proportional to the digital input, with low glitch energy ensuring minimal transient disturbances during updates. This makes the MAX5841MEUB suitable for applications requiring smooth and precise analog signals.

Key Features

The MAX5841MEUB offers several key features that set it apart from other DACs. Its 10-bit resolution ensures fine granularity in analog output, while its low power consumption makes it ideal for battery-operated devices. The serial interface supports both SPI and I2C protocols, providing flexibility in system design. Additionally, the device boasts low glitch energy, which minimizes unwanted transient signals during updates. Its excellent linearity and low integral nonlinearity (INL) ensure accurate analog output across the entire operating range. These features make the MAX5841MEUB a reliable choice for high-precision applications.

Application Areas

The MAX5841MEUB is widely used in various applications, including audio equipment, where it converts digital audio signals to analog for playback. It is also employed in instrumentation and control systems, providing precise analog outputs for sensors and actuators. Industrial automation systems benefit from the DAC's accuracy and reliability, using it to control motor speeds, valve positions, and other analog processes. Consumer electronics, such as smart home devices and portable gadgets, also leverage the MAX5841MEUB for its low power consumption and compact size.

Maintenance and Precautions

To ensure optimal performance and longevity of the MAX5841MEUB, proper handling and maintenance are essential. Always use electrostatic discharge (ESD) protection when handling the device to prevent damage from static electricity. Ensure that the operating voltage levels are within the specified range to avoid overvoltage or undervoltage conditions. Regularly inspect the device for signs of physical damage or overheating. If the DAC is used in harsh environments, consider additional protection measures, such as conformal coating or enclosure sealing, to safeguard against moisture and contaminants.
